What are e ink android phones and how do they work?

An e ink android phone combines the flexibility of Android with an electronic paper display that reflects surrounding light instead of generating its own illumination. Tiny pigment particles move within microscopic capsules to form text and images, creating a paper-like viewing experience that remains readable even in bright sunlight.

Unlike conventional LCD or OLED smartphones that constantly refresh illuminated pixels, an android phone with e ink display only consumes significant display power when the screen content changes. That design contributes to exceptional battery efficiency while creating a calmer viewing experience for reading and productivity.

  • Paper-like readability with minimal glare
  • Very low blue light exposure from the display itself
  • Ultra-low power consumption during static content
  • Excellent outdoor visibility, even in direct sunlight
  • Ideal for reading, messaging, notes, and focused work

The trade-off is a slower screen refresh compared with traditional smartphones. Fast-moving animations, gaming, and video playback are less fluid, but for text-based activities many users find the increased comfort worthwhile.

How does e ink display vs OLED eye comfort compare?

The biggest difference between an e ink phone and an OLED smartphone is how each display produces an image. OLED panels emit light directly from individual pixels, while an e ink screen phone reflects external light much like ordinary paper. This fundamental difference often results in a more comfortable reading experience, particularly during long sessions or in bright outdoor environments.

Feature E Ink Display OLED Display
Light Source Reflective (paper-like) Self-emitting pixels
Eye Comfort for Reading Excellent during extended sessions Good, but depends on brightness settings
Blue Light Exposure Minimal from the display itself Higher than reflective displays
Outdoor Visibility Excellent in sunlight Can be reduced by glare
Refresh Speed Slower Very fast
Best For Reading, writing, productivity Video, gaming, multimedia

While no display can completely eliminate eye strain caused by prolonged screen use, an e ink android phone can help reduce visual fatigue for users who spend hours reading documents, ebooks, articles, or messages. Combined with sensible brightness settings, regular screen breaks, and good ambient lighting, an e ink display offers one of the most comfortable mobile reading experiences currently available.

How long battery e ink smartphone android models really last

Battery endurance is one of the strongest reasons people choose an e ink android phone. Since the display consumes very little power when showing static content, these devices typically last several times longer than conventional smartphones used for similar reading and productivity tasks.

  • Typical OLED or LCD smartphone: approximately 1 day of regular use.
  • E ink android phone: commonly 3 to 7 days, depending on usage patterns, battery capacity, wireless connectivity, and screen refresh frequency.

Reading ebooks, reviewing documents, writing notes, and messaging place relatively little demand on the display, allowing the battery to stretch much further than traditional phones. Heavy use of GPS, mobile data, downloads, or processor-intensive applications will still reduce runtime, but battery life generally remains well above that of comparable smartphones.

Buying Guide: How to Choose the Right E Ink Android Phone

The best e ink android phone depends on how you plan to use it. Some models are designed primarily for reading and note-taking, while others offer a more complete Android experience with access to everyday apps. Before buying, consider the following factors.

Software support

Look for devices running a recent version of Android with regular firmware updates. Better software support improves security, app compatibility, and long-term usability.

Google Play compatibility

Not every android phone with e ink display includes Google Play services out of the box. If you rely on Gmail, Google Maps, Drive, or the Play Store, verify compatibility before purchasing.

Connectivity

Check whether the phone supports the features you use most, including 4G or 5G connectivity,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, NFC for contactless payments, USB-C charging, and expandable storage where available.

Long-term value

Consider battery capacity, build quality, manufacturer support, repairability, and overall performance instead of focusing only on price. A quality e ink smartphone can remain useful for years if your priorities are reading, productivity, and digital wellness rather than multimedia.

How bad is ghosting on modern E Ink phones?

Modern devices significantly reduce ghosting through improved refresh modes, although faint image retention may still appear during certain tasks until the screen performs a full refresh.

Do E Ink smartphones support 5G and NFC?

Support varies by model. Premium devices are more likely to include features such as 5G, NFC, Bluetooth, and advanced wireless connectivity.

Are color E Ink phones worth buying?

If you frequently read magazines, comics, charts, or color documents, they can be worthwhile. However, monochrome displays generally provide higher contrast, faster performance, and longer battery life.
